If the Watergate scandal was a previous generation's National Nightmare, then maybe the Clinton scandal was our National Wet Dream, and who better to narrate it than the screenwriter JoeEszterhas? In "American Rhapsody," Eszterhas, whose credits include "Basic Instinct" and "Showgirls, "and "Charlie Simpson's Apocalypse, " forwhich he was nominated for a National Book Award, takes us through the events that threatened to topple a president and left most of the nation's citizens with, at the very least, a bad taste in theirmouths.Taking full advantage of his considerable journalistic and storytelling talents, Eszterhas gives us every fact, rumor, or innuendo surrounding the president'sfoibles in the context of late century American politics and entertainment. Here Washington and Hollywood do more than just flirt with each other; they share the same bed. From scandalmongers MattDrudge (who began as a Hollywood gossip) and Ken Starr, to would-be president paramours Sharon Stone and Barbra Streisand, to his final, unimpeachable witness, Willard--none other than President Clinton's talkingpenis--Eszterhas gives us the goods on the story that nobody could stop talking about and, thanks to "American Rhapsody, "will be impossible to think about the same wayagain."From the Trade Paperback edition."words : 183901
